在日常網頁開發中,我們經常需要對日期進行一些計算,尤其是在一些時間敏感的任務中。而javascript正好有一些內置的方法可以實現這一計算,其中包括加一年,下面我們就來詳細介紹一下。
首先我們先來看一下,如何在javascript中獲取當前時間。通常我們可以使用Date對象,并調用其內置方法。
var currentDate = new Date(); //獲取當前日期時間 console.log(currentDate);
運行以上代碼,可得到當前日期時間的輸出。
接著我們來看,如何將日期加上一年。同樣使用Date對象,在其原有基礎上添加一年,代碼如下所示。
var currentDate = new Date(); //獲取當前日期時間 currentDate.setFullYear(currentDate.getFullYear()+1); //將年份加一 console.log(currentDate);
運行以上代碼,可得到當前日期時間加上一年的輸出。
下面是一個完整的案例,我們可以在其中隨意修改,驗證我們對javascript加一年的理解。
javascript加一年示例 輸入一個日期:
加上一年后的日期是:
在以上代碼中,我們首先獲取用戶在輸入框中輸入的日期,并將其轉為Date對象。然后調用setFullYear方法,將其加上一年。最后將結果轉為字符串,并輸出到結果框中。
總結:javascript的內置方法可以方便地實現日期計算,而加上一年只需要調用setFullYear,并指定年份加一即可。